📞 01225 000 000Everdent PDR works out of Melksham, so most jobs in the town are a few minutes away rather than a trip out. That matters more than it sounds. It means we can look at a car the same week rather than fitting it around a run across the county, and it means we already know where the damage tends to happen here.
The Market Place and Church Street end of town is the usual culprit for door dings. Bays are tight, the parking turns over all day, and it only takes one shopping trolley or one door caught by the wind to leave a dent the size of a ten pence piece in a rear quarter. The car parks around the Bowerhill and Semington Road employers are the other one, where cars sit side by side from seven in the morning until knocking off time.
Then there are the terraced streets running off Spa Road and Union Street, where on street parking is the only option and cars park nose to tail overnight. Passing wing mirrors, wheelie bins and bikes leave shallow dents down the flanks that a bodyshop would want to fill and respray. We would rather work the metal back and leave the factory paint alone.
Most Melksham jobs fall into a handful of types. Car park damage from doors and trolleys, longer creases from a wall or a gatepost on a tight driveway, and folded door edges from garages and narrow parking spaces. Hail is rarer here but it does happen, and when it does it is usually the roof, bonnet and boot lid that take it.
